Stanley Park

Stanley Park is one of Vancouver’s most iconic landmarks, offering a mix of forest, trails, and oceanfront. It’s a must-see for anyone visiting the city, known for its stunning views of the mountains and skyline. The park is home to the Vancouver Aquarium, as well as over 230 species of birds and numerous walking and cycling trails. Visitors can explore the famous Seawall or take a guided tour to learn about the park’s history.

Granville Island

Granville Island is a lively cultural district located in the heart of Vancouver. This area is famous for its public market, where visitors can sample fresh local produce, gourmet food, and handcrafted goods. It also hosts a variety of art galleries, studios, and theaters. The island is easily accessible by boat, providing a picturesque view of the city from the water. Granville Island offers an opportunity to immerse yourself in the city’s arts and culinary culture.

Capilano Suspension Bridge Park

Another key attraction is the Capilano Suspension Bridge Park, located just north of the city. This park features a 137-meter-long bridge that offers breathtaking views of the surrounding rainforest and river below. Visitors can also walk along the Treetop Walkway or explore the Cliffwalk, a series of suspended walkways attached to the cliffside. The park is a popular spot for those seeking an adrenaline rush with panoramic views of Vancouver’s natural beauty.

Vancouver Art Gallery

The Vancouver Art Gallery is a premier cultural institution that displays a wide variety of Canadian and Indigenous art. It is located in downtown Vancouver, housed in a beautiful heritage building. The gallery features permanent and temporary exhibits, offering visitors an insightful look into the history and creativity of Canada’s artistic landscape. The museum also hosts educational programs and public events that engage visitors with art and culture.
